Transaction 105d8df34153b75a730b958ff82eb0bfb3ff43f0bb47caf3e2ba4f2af99e53c3
1 Input
1 Output
-
105d8df34153b75a730b958ff82eb0bfb3ff43f0bb47caf3e2ba4f2af99e53c3:0
- value
- 715600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18cc698754a8e7d943d11a70c33f37324fe30b6b OP_EQUAL
- address
- 33x91xWKKSbGmJqrUJCz6NevEpZyd8D1Kt